Пример #1
0
        public void SeparadorEsGuion()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            int     largo      = formateada.Length;

            Assert.AreEqual(largo, 10);
        }
Пример #2
0
        public void AnioEsMayorIgualQueCero()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            int     resultado  = int.Parse(formateada.Substring(6));

            Assert.Greater(resultado, 0);
        }
Пример #3
0
        public void DiaEsMayorQueCero()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            int     dia        = int.Parse(formateada.Substring(0, 2));

            Assert.Greater(dia, 0);
        }
Пример #4
0
        public void ValidoSiElTextoTieneEspacios()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("  10/11/1977  ");
            string  esperado   = "10-11-1977";

            Assert.AreEqual(esperado, formateada);
        }
Пример #5
0
        public void MesEsMayorQueCero()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            int     mes        = int.Parse(formateada.Substring(3, 2));

            Assert.Greater(mes, 0);
        }
Пример #6
0
        public void SeparadorEsGuion()
        {
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            string  separador  = formateada.Substring(2, 1);

            Assert.AreEqual(separador, "-");
        }
Пример #7
0
        public void AnioEsMenorIgualQueLimiteSuperior()
        {
            int     limite     = 9999;
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/11/1977");
            int     resultado  = int.Parse(formateada.Substring(6));

            Assert.LessOrEqual(resultado, limite);
        }
Пример #8
0
        public void DiaEsMenorQueTreintaYUno()
        {
            int     limite     = 31;
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/13/1977");
            int     dia        = int.Parse(formateada.Substring(0, 2));

            Assert.LessOrEqual(dia, limite);
        }
Пример #9
0
        public void MesEsMenorQueDoce()
        {
            int     limite     = 12;
            Formato formato    = new Formato();
            string  formateada = Formato.ChangeFormat("10/13/1977");
            int     mes        = int.Parse(formateada.Substring(5, 2));

            Assert.LessOrEqual(mes, limite);
        }
Пример #10
0
        public static void Main(string[] args)
        {
            string testDate = "10/11/1977";

            Console.WriteLine("{0} se convierte a: {1} ", testDate, Formato.ChangeFormat(testDate));
        }